Message type: E = Error
Message class: EI - Foreign Trade: Gen. Output
Message number: 151
Message text: Usage of procedure & in goods direction & for country &
You have entered the export/import procedure &V1& in the goods
direction &V2& for country &V3&.
Depending on the settings in the Implementation Guide (IMG) for foreign
trade, the system either gives you information, a warning or an error
message, informing you that certain export/import procedures can only
be used for certain business transactions (import-inbound transport or
export-goods dispatch, for example).
You either tried to maintain a procedure as an import procedure when it
is already defined in the IMG under 'Basic data for foreign trade'
exclusively as an export procedure, or vice versa.

- Usage of procedure & in goods direction & for country & ?The SAP error message EI151 typically relates to issues with the configuration of the system regarding the usage of procedures in the context of goods movements, particularly in relation to specific countries. This error can occur in various scenarios, such as during the posting of goods movements, inventory management, or when dealing with customs procedures.
Cause:
The error message EI151 indicates that there is a problem with the configuration of the procedure being used for the goods movement. This could be due to several reasons, including:
- Missing Configuration: The procedure for the specified goods direction (e.g., import, export) and country may not be defined in the system.
- Incorrect Settings: The settings for the procedure may not align with the requirements for the specific country or goods direction.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the goods movement with the specified procedure.
-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the master data or transaction data that prevent the procedure from being executed.
